Weather forecast: Storm 'Alfie' will reach Israel on Wednesday and is expected to bring snow to Jerusalem as well.

According to Sharon Wechsler's forecast on Kan News, this is expected to be a short system, with snow falling on Mount Hermon and the Golan Heights starting Wednesday morning. In the afternoon, the snow will gradually begin to fall in the Galilee and the central mountains, including Jerusalem - and is expected to pile up on the ground.

In the second half of the day, the winds will strengthen and will weaken only on Thursday morning. There is a risk of flooding along the coastal plain. The rain and snow will weaken and diminish in the second half of the night.

Today, the rain returns to the north and will gradually spread to the center of the country. On Monday morning, light snow is possible in the Golan Heights and the northern mountains, and then there will be a brief respite in precipitation, and even a slight increase in temperatures on Tuesday.

Wednesday, as mentioned, will again be particularly wintry, with a risk of flooding in the coastal plain and a chance of snow in the central mountains.

According to the Meteo-Tech forecast, tomorrow there will be occasional rain, mainly in the north and center of the country. It will be colder than usual, and in the morning there may be light snow in the northern Golan Heights. The winds will weaken. In the afternoon the rain will decrease and gradually stop. At night there will be a possibility of cold in the interior of the country and in the mountains.

A temporary break in the rain is expected on Tuesday, and temperatures will rise slightly. Rain will resume in the north of the country at night.

Wednesday will be rainy and stormy. Heavy rain will fall in the north and center of the country, accompanied by thunderstorms and hail. There is a risk of flooding and inundation in the coastal plain, the lowlands and the streams. There will be a strong wind in the Negev and there may be sandstorms. From the afternoon, the rain will also spread to the Negev and there is a risk of flooding.

Snow will fall on Mount Hermon and the northern Golan Heights. In the afternoon, extremely cold air will enter the country, and snow will begin to fall in the Galilee Mountains. In the evening, the snow is also expected to spread to the central mountains that are over 700 meters high, including Jerusalem.

On Thursday, the rains will weaken slightly but will continue to fall from the north of the country to the Negev. In the morning, snow is still possible on the mountain peaks of the north and center.

The maximum temperatures expected today: in Jerusalem up to 10 degrees, in Tel Aviv up to 15, in Haifa up to 12, in Safed up to 7, in Beer Sheva up to 14, and in Eilat up to 20 degrees.
